Content: 

An experienced marine mammal trainer/educator will lead students through a fun and informative demonstration and discussion of the following with the help of some of DRC’s amazing dolphins

  • Discover a dolphin’s unique personality and explore and understand the concepts of how and why we train animals and the importance of building strong, trusting relationships
  • Discover principles behind Operant Conditioning and how we use it with our dolphins
    • What is operant conditioning?
    • Positive stimulus: conditioned and unconditioned reinforcers
    • Non reinforcement
  • Observe & Review Training Techniques/Tools  and Applications
    • Bridging
    • Behavior Chains
    • Symbols
    • Target poles/targeting
    • Pinger
  • Observe & Discuss Methods of Training
    • Direct Manipulation
    • Opportunistic Training
    • Modeling
    • Shaping (approximations)
  • Discover Careers with Marine Mammals
    • What are the typical pathways for a career in training
  • Marine Mammal Conservation
    • Why understanding animal training helps us better understand dolphins in the wild
    • Natural & human caused threats in the wild
    • Conservation efforts you can do at home to help dolphins and your environment
  • Participate in a question and answer session at the end to get at those “always wanted to know” questions.
